Someone once observed: "America is great because she is good; if she ever ceases to be good she will cease to be great." Today that notion of the essential goodness of America is under attack, replaced by another story in which theft and plunder are seen as the defining features of American history—from the theft of Native American and Mexican lands and the exploitation of African labor to a contemporary foreign policy said to be based on stealing oil and a capitalist system that robs people of their "fair share". 

Our founding fathers warned us that, although the freedoms they gave us were hard fought, they could very easily be lost. America stands at a crossroads, and the way we understand our past will determine our future. America the movie takes 21st-century Americans into the future by first visiting our past. 

Gerald Molen, the Academy-award winning producer of Schindler's List, and Dinesh D'Souza, the creator of 2016: Obama's America, invite you on a journey of discovery that will bring you face-to-face with the heroes who built America, in the times in which they lived, bled, and sacrificed in order to build a great nation: Christopher Columbus, George Washington, Abraham Lincoln, Frederick Douglass, and others. You'll be there as Columbus sets foot on American soil, as bullets whiz by Washington's head, as Douglass demands that America live up to the promises of her Founding Fathers, and as Lincoln sacrifices thousands of lives, including his own, to right a great wrong of history.

We'll also meet their present-day critics, hear their stories, and then let you decide which America you believe in. From the team that created 2016: Obama's America comes the story not of a man but a nation, at the crossroads of hope or disaster, whose destination will soon be decided.

FINALLY... I got to see this movie!  Well worth the wait... it was great!  Not exactly what I was expecting (I thought, from the title, it would be more of a speculation on how the world would look if America never existed).  Instead, I found that it was a very hard hitting, critical look at America and the many sins she's been accused of by those who hate us.  

The first 30 minutes were difficult to sit through... I despise America-bashing and D'Souza gave time generously, to those who believe this country is inherently evil.  He knocks you down with interviews of college professors, race-baitors, communists and collectivists of every stripe.  They complain about the hypocrisy of our founders, the treatment of the Native Americans, the slave-trade, how we bully other nations, that we are guilty of theft and destruction all over the world. 

Wait for it...

He takes each charge and demolishes it!  America is an "idea"... an experiment.  We differ from all other countries because we recognize that each of us is a minority OF ONE. Americans are individuals and we believe... we value above all else... that we have unalienable rights to LIFE, LIBERTY AND THE PURSUIT OF HAPPINESS.  Are we perfect?  NO.  But it is freedom that sets us apart.  Freedom to succeed or fail... to reach our individual potential or squander it.  That is our real strength... the human spirit unfettered by the tyranny of government overreach.  There is no army in the world that can take us down.  Our demise can ONLY happen from WITHIN.  And that is what is happening now.  

To my brothers and sisters on the left... I challenge you... I implore you... I BEG you to go see this documentary.  We have all been told and taught that America is an evil, greedy, thieving nation and that we shouldn't be proud of her because all we do is take and meddle and kill and consume.  Open your minds and your hearts to the truth before its too late.  See for yourselves that, though we're not perfect... as a nation nor as individuals... we have so much to be proud of.  We must come together. 

Our National Anthem is the only one that ends in a question...

"Oh, say does that star-spangled banner yet wave

O'er the land of the free and the home of the brave?"
